Description

Thiourea, n-[Imino(Methylamino)Methyl]-n-Phenyl- is a specialized thiourea derivative with a phenyl substituent, offering unique chemical reactivity. This compound matters for its role as a versatile intermediate in synthesizing complex molecules, particularly in pharmaceutical and agrochemical research. It is needed by R&D chemists and process development scientists in the fine chemical, pharmaceutical, and crop protection industries for constructing novel active ingredients and functional materials.

Application

  • Pharmaceutical Intermediate: Key building block in the synthesis of novel drug candidates, particularly those requiring thiourea or guanidine-like pharmacophores.
  • Agrochemical Synthesis: Used in the research and development of new herbicides, fungicides, and plant growth regulators.
  • Chemical Research Reagent: Serves as a versatile reagent in organic synthesis for constructing heterocycles and as a ligand or catalyst precursor in coordination chemistry.
  • Polymer Additive Precursor: Can be utilized to develop specialty monomers or additives that impart specific properties like UV stabilization or metal chelation to polymers.
  • Dye and Pigment Intermediate: Acts as an intermediate in the synthesis of certain specialty dyes and organic pigments.

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ated place at room temperature (15-25°C). This material is hygroscopic (moisture-sensitive); ensure the container is kept tightly sealed to minimize exposure to atmospheric humidity.
